Tsuta Onsen
Tsuta Onsen, nestled in the tranquil forests of Towada, Japan, offers an authentic ryokan experience that captures the essence of traditional Japanese hospitality.

Renowned for its natural hot springs, this hotel provides a serene retreat where guests can unwind and reconnect with nature. The mineral-rich waters are said to have healing properties, making for a rejuvenating soak after exploring the surrounding landscapes.
Guests at Tsuta Onsen frequently enjoy walking tours through the nearby Oirase Gorge, celebrated for its breathtaking waterfalls and lush scenery. Lake Towada is another popular destination, offering picturesque views and opportunities for leisurely boat rides. For those interested in cultural experiences, the Hakkoda Mountains provide remarkable hiking trails that enhance any stay with panoramic vistas.
The ryokan’s design emphasizes harmony with its environment, featuring tatami-matted rooms and sliding shoji screens which contribute to an immersive cultural experience. Dining at Tsuta Onsen presents another highlight; seasonal ingredients are crafted into exquisite kaiseki meals that delight even discerning palates.
While the traditional setting may lack some modern amenities like Wi-Fi in all rooms or extensive entertainment options found in urban hotels, these factors ensure a truly peaceful escape from everyday life.
